class SerienServer(IdentifierBase2):
    def __init__(self):
        IdentifierBase2.__init__(self)

        self.server = TimeoutServerProxy()

    @classmethod
    def knowsElapsed(cls):
        return True

    @classmethod
    def knowsToday(cls):
        return True

    @classmethod
    def knowsFuture(cls):
        return True

    def getLogo(self, future=True, today=False, elapsed=False):
        if future:
            return "Wunschliste"
        elif today:
            return "Wunschliste"
        else:
            return "Fernsehserien"

    def getEpisode(self, name, begin, end=None, service=None):
        # On Success: Return a single season, episode, title tuple
        # On Failure: Return a empty list or String or None

        # Check preconditions
        if not name:
            msg = _("Skipping lookup because no show name is specified")
            log.warning(msg)
            return msg
        if not begin:
            msg = _("Skipping lookup because no begin timestamp is specified")
            log.warning(msg)
            return msg
        if not service:
            msg = _("Skipping lookup because no channel is specified")
            log.warning(msg)
            return msg

        self.name = name
        self.begin = begin
        self.end = end
        self.service = service

        log.info("SerienServer getEpisode, name, begin, end=None, service",
                 name, begin, end, service)

        # Prepare parameters
        webChannels = lookupChannelByReference(service)
        if not webChannels:
            msg = _("No matching channel found.") + "\n" + getChannel(
                service
            ) + " (" + str(service) + ")\n\n" + _(
                "Please open the Channel Editor and add the channel manually.")
            log.warning(msg)
            return msg

        unixtime = str(begin)
        max_time_drift = self.max_time_drift

        # Lookup
        for webChannel in webChannels:
            log.debug(
                "SerienServer getSeasonEpisode(): [\"%s\",\"%s\",\"%s\",%s]" %
                (name, webChannel, unixtime, max_time_drift))

            result = self.server.getSeasonEpisode(name, webChannel, unixtime,
                                                  self.max_time_drift)

            if result and isinstance(result, dict):
                result['service'] = service
                result['channel'] = webChannel
                result['begin'] = begin

            log.debug("SerienServer getSeasonEpisode result:", type(result),
                      result)

            return result

        else:
            return (_("No match found"))
